MFG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

209 of the 6,859 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Mizuho Financial (MFG)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$349M — up 34% from $261M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 46 funds opened new MFG positions and 9 closed out — a net gain of 37 holders — while 98 added to existing stakes and 46 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$71.5M. The largest seller was Silvercrest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.04M sold.
